Serves as advanced technologist for an individual technology or set of technologies. Work closely with Technology management, senior Engineers, and support teams on a regular basis to implement and manage the design, development, and execution of technical solutions that meet or exceed current and future needs of the organization. Responsibilities may include infrastructure review, implementation, and design, creation of support and architectural documentation, standards, policies, analysis, and testing.

What You'll Do:
Regularly and independently interact with business partners of varying associate and management levels to ensure clarity of the problem/opportunity and elicit business requirements. Coordinate vendor interactions and/or vendor resources as needed. Mentor and coach less experienced engineers, technicians, and integrators. Review documentation, proposals, and changes proposed by less experienced staff. Seek to expand knowledge and understanding of Financial Services trends, practices, and technologies on a continuous basis. Follow and promote use of industry best practices, standards and procedures. Maintain a strong aptitude and working knowledge of Bank applications, systems, development environments. Maintain a detailed understanding of vendor technologies and services used by the Bank. Understand and adhere to the Company's risk and regulatory standards, policies and controls in accordance with the Company's Risk Appetite. Identify risk-related issues needing escalation to management. Promote an environment that supports diversity and reflects the client brand. Maintain client internal control standards, including timely implementation of internal and external audit points together with any issues raised by external regulators as applicable. Complete other related duties as assigned.
